Why Choosing the Right Best Studio Monitors for Small Room Matters

The size of your studio directly impacts how sound behaves. Using oversized monitors in a confined area can lead to overwhelming bass and inaccurate mixes. The best studio monitors for small room are engineered to provide a balanced frequency response, ensuring your mixes translate well across different playback systems. Choosing wisely prevents ear fatigue, enhances productivity, and saves time during the editing process. Buying Guide for Best Studio Monitors for Small Room

Key Features to Look For

When choosing the best studio monitors for small room, consider driver size, connectivity, frequency response, and acoustic tuning. Models like the PreSonus Eris 4.5BT Bluetooth Studio Monitors or Ortizan C7 Dual-Mode 2.0 Studio Monitors are compact yet powerful options. Smaller woofers (3–5 inches) generally perform best in limited spaces.

Performance & Sound Accuracy

Flat frequency response is crucial. Monitors such as the PreSonus Eris E5 2-Way Near Field Studio Monitor or Yamaha HS3 Powered Studio Monitor are designed to deliver accurate sound without coloration, making them perfect for small studio mixing.
